Purpose of Role

The Analytics Technology branch of the Business Analytics Team focuses on data capture, tool administration, and data architecture/enablement of global web and mobile app data for client The mission of Analytics Technology is to govern, centralize, and democratize eComm data sources to enable a holistic view of our shoppers (not just buyers). This foundation enables running analytics at scale, eComm insights, and advancing the capabilities of all analytics teams.

As an Analytics Engineer, you will:

  • Support platform migration projects by preventing and resolving analytics tracking issues on websites and native apps.
  • Implement and enhance analytics tracking on all platforms.
  • Debug and troubleshoot configurations and integrations Adobe MobileSDK and Kotlin KMP, clearly communicating findings to responsible teams.
  • Lead or support the upgrade of analytics implementations ensuring data continuity, privacy compliance, and performance optimization.
Qualifications Required
  • Passionate about data and a champion for analytics governance and enablement to support 300+ global business users.
  • Extensive experience with tag managers, specifically Tealium and Adobe Data Collection (Launch).
  • Skilled at performing and documenting beacon tests using Adobe Assurance, AEP Debugger, and Omnibug.
  • Reliable partner with strong communication and collaboration skills.
  • Expert at troubleshooting and debugging web/mobile analytics implementations.
  • Experience validating tagging implementations using Adobe Workspace.
  • Familiarity with data layers, tag management, processing rules, and mobile SDK context data variables.
  • Hands-on experience upgrading analytics implementations through platform and library transitions
